Telcoin closes at a 90-day high on 7.7x average volume — up 42% in 7 days
- TEL (Telcoin) hit a 90-day closing high of $0.00290 on May 12 while posting a 9-day winning streak
- Volume on May 12 was 1.63 billion units — 7.7 times the 90-day daily average of 211 million, the single largest volume day for TEL in the 90-day window
- The combination of a new price high and a massive volume spike on the same day signals unusually strong conviction behind the move

Conclusion
Close on 2026-05-12: $0.002903 (90-day high; 90-day low: $0.001970). 7d return: +41.95% (from $0.002045). 30d return: +41.34%. Volume May 12: 1,631,240,580 vs 90-day average (prior to May 12): 211,410,998 — ratio: 7.72x. 9 consecutive up days confirmed by streak query.
